How much does it cost to rent a home in Riverdale?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Riverdale 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,468 | $617 | $3,000 |
| Riverdale 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,796 | $1,000 | $4,200 |
| Riverdale 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,109 | $1,200 | $5,950 |
| Riverdale 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,451 | $1,495 | $3,500 |
| Riverdale 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$800 | $800 | $800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Riverdale
What type of rentals are currently available in Riverdale?
There are currently 173 Apartments for Rent in Riverdale, GA with pricing that ranges from $575 to $12,982. There are also 358 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Riverdale ranging from $570 to $5,950.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Riverdale?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Riverdale ranges from $570 to $5,950 with an average monthly rent of $1,598.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Riverdale?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Riverdale range from $1,150 to $3,299,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,000 to $4,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,550.
